Technical Considerations and Cautionary Notes
While I love this asset, honest craftsmanship requires acknowledging its limitations. You must use caution when applying this design to very small surfaces. The finer details of the buildings, such as thin chimneys or narrow windows, may bridge or tear if cut too small on vinyl. Always perform a test cut on scrap material before committing to a full batch of customer orders.
Additionally, be mindful of crowded compositions. If you layer this silhouette over busy patterns or textured backgrounds, the detail can get lost. It thrives in negative space. For layered vinyl projects, ensure you simplify the layout if necessary. Removing some of the internal window details might be required for smaller sticker design applications to maintain structural integrity.
Another critical point is color contrast. On dark products, ensure you are using a light-colored vinyl or ink. If you are sublimating onto dark shirts, remember that standard sublimation does not print white. You may need to use a white underbase or choose light-colored garments to make the illustration visible.
